The Kiev regime is actively preparing the legislative ground, because it understands perfectly well that it can only hold on to bayonets. This was stated by former Prime Minister of Ukraine Mykola Azarov.
"The puppet Rada plans to vote in the second reading next week for a new version of bill No. 10311. The document has already been approved by the law enforcement parliamentary committee.
The National Guard will be given the right to use firearms, rubber and plastic batons, tear gas and stun guns against protesters without warning. Security forces will be allowed to mark violators, for example, with paint. Also, the National Guard will be able to use drones, including to monitor the protesters," Azarov writes in his telegram channel.
As reported by EADaily, the law enforcement Committee of the Verkhovna Rada voted in favor of a bill that gives the National Guard the right to use firearms against its own unarmed citizens. The oppositional Ukrainian MP Artem Dmytruk, who fled abroad after being tortured by the SBU, writes about this in his telegram channel.
